Job Description
The House Parent is a key role within the School responsible for ensuring the provision of a high level of social and pastoral care and support for our international and domestic boarding students both individually and as a group within the Boarding House.
This care and support is delivered to boarders through the management of a team of House Parents and a range of other staff. House Parents are a supervising, adult presence in the Boarding House, committed to ensuring the health and wellbeing of our boarding students and to assist them in their daily lives.
